Why postpone the start of primary and secondary schools?
First of all, the delay in starting school is related to the date arrangement this year. Under normal circumstances, school starts in autumn on September 1 day, and students report, hand in their homework and get new books on August 30 and 3 1 day, which has become a routine and rarely changes. However, this year's situation is quite special. Many regions have issued the notice of "postponing the start of school" in advance, and changed the date of student registration from September 1 to September 4, which is equivalent to delaying for three days. Officially, this is an adjustment based on actual needs. September 1 falls on Friday, and the 2nd and 3rd are weekends. According to the regulations, students should have a holiday. Therefore, the education department has made corresponding adjustments according to the actual situation, allowing students to report in September 1 and officially start the autumn course on September 4, so as to achieve the continuity of the course.

Secondly, the delay in starting school may lead to a late winter vacation. Although delaying the start of school will also affect the end time of winter vacation, on the whole, the difference is only a few days, which is acceptable to both students and parents. Moreover, for students who are about to start school, they can have more time to finish their summer homework, which reduces the sense of urgency in catching up with their homework.

It is a realistic decision to postpone the start of school. For students and parents, their views and attitudes towards this matter may be completely different. Students will naturally feel happy, even if the school is postponed for three days, they will be very happy, because they can have a few more days to finish their homework and reduce the pressure.
